컨테이너의 내용을 단순히 지우는 clear() 함수를 구현합니다. 예를 들어,
예시
clear() { this.container = {} }
다음을 사용하여 테스트할 수 있습니다.
예시
const myMap = new MyMap(); myMap.put("key1", "value1"); myMap.put("key2", "value2"); myMap.display(); myMap.clear(); myMap.display();
출력
이것은 출력을 줄 것입니다 -
{ key1: 'value1', key2: 'value2' }
ES6 맵에서도 같은 방법으로 clear 메소드를 사용할 수 있습니다. 예를 들어,
예시
const myMap = new Map([ ["key1", "value1"], ["key2", "value2"] ]); console.log(myMap) myMap.clear(); console.log(myMap)
출력
이것은 출력을 줄 것입니다 -
Map { 'key1' => 'value1', 'key2' => 'value2' } Map {}